循环结构For+i+=+100+to+1+step+-4中,循环体执行的次数为______。+‍+A.+26

1个回答
展开全部
摘要 亲,答案:B哦。解释:在循环体B中,初始值i为10,每次循环i加1,直到i大于0时结束循环。因为i会一直递增,所以循环体B能正常结束。循环体A、C、D的结束条件都无法满足,会导致死循环。其中,循环体A中i会一直递增,循环条件i小于0无法满足;循环体C中i会一直递增,循环条件i等于10无法满足;循环体D中i会一直递减,循环条件i等于1.5或1.8时无法满足。
咨询记录 · 回答于2023-05-15
循环结构For+i+=+100+to+1+step+-4中,循环体执行的次数为______。+‍+A.+26
亲,晚上好!循环结构For+i+=+100+to+1+step+-4中,每次循环i的值会减去4。因为循环变量i的初值为100,所以循环体执行的次数为(100-1)/4 + 1 = 25。另外,循环体会在i=1时执行一次,因此总共执行26次。因此,答案为26哦
执行下面的程序段后,s的值为______。‍​ Dim s As String, i As Integer, flag As Boolean‍​ s = "this is a book"‍​ flag = True‍​ For i = 1 To Len(s)‍​ If Mid(s, i, 1) = " " Then‍​ flag = True‍​ ElseIf flag Then‍​ s = Strings.Left(s, i - 1) & UCase(Mid(s, i, 1)) & Strings.Right(s, Len(s) - i)‍​ flag = False‍​ End If‍​ Next i‍A.this is a bookB.BOOKC.ThisD.This Is A Book
亲,答案是D哦. This Is A Book.程序的作用是将字符串s中每个单词的首字母大写。程序中使用了一个flag变量来判断当前字符是否为单
以下程序执行完毕后,在消息框中显示的消息是______。‌‌ Dim k as integer‌‌ For k=1 to 5 step 2‌‌ k=k+3‌‌ Next‌‌ MsgBox(k)‌A.3B.5C.6D.4
亲,在执行完以上程序后,消息框中将显示数字6,即选项C。在循环迭代时,每次增加2到k的值,但在循环体中,将k增加3,因此k的最终值为6哦
好滴谢谢
下列循环体能正常结束的是______。‎A.i = 5Do i = i + 1Loop Until i 0B.i = 10Do i = i + 1Loop Until i > 0C.i = 1Do i = i + 2Loop Until i = 10D.i = 6Do i = i - 2Loop Until i = 1
亲,答案:B哦。解释:在循环体B中,初始值i为10,每次循环i加1,直到i大于0时结束循环。因为i会一直递增,所以循环体B能正常结束。循环体A、C、D的结束条件都无法满足,会导致死循环。其中,循环体A中i会一直递增,循环条件i小于0无法满足;循环体C中i会一直递增,循环条件i等于10无法满足;循环体D中i会一直递减,循环条件i等于1.5或1.8时无法满足。
下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消